A Git pull request is essentially the same as a Git merge request. Both requests achieve the same result: merging a developers branch with the projects master or main branch. Their difference lies in which site they are used; GitHub uses the Git pull request, and GitLab uses the Git merge request.

When the pipeline succeeds, the merge request is automatically merged. When the pipeline fails, the author gets a chance to retry any failed jobs, or to push new commits to fix the failure. When the jobs are retried and succeed on the second try, the merge request is automatically merged.
A merge train is a queued list of merge requests, each waiting to be merged into the target branch. Many merge requests can be added to the train. Each merge request runs its own merged results pipeline, which includes the changes from all of the other merge requests in front of it on the train.
You can configure your pipeline to run every time you commit changes to a branch. This type of pipeline is called a branch pipeline. Alternatively, you can configure your pipeline to run every time you make changes to the source branch for a merge request. This type of pipeline is called a merge request pipeline.
